[Operating Memory]
1. Select the settings on the receiver you want to
memorize.
2. Press the MEMORY
button.
After the "AUTO
SOURCE
CONTROL"
indication has
scrolled in the display, "MEMORY" appears and flashes.
3. 5SWLLAC Press the AUTO SOURCE CONTROL button
(1 or 2) that you want to use for memorizing.
Example:
Using the AUTO SOURCE CONTROL 1 button to memorize
settings to start play on a CD player connected to the
receiver's CONTROL OUT jack.
1. Set the receiver input selector to CD.
2. Adjust tone, surround, and other parameters to the
settings that you want to memorize.
3. Press the MEMORY button.
4. Press the AUTO SOURCE CONTROL 1 button.
"MEMORY 1" flashes in the display for about five seconds.
NOTE:
* If you press another button while "MEMORY 1" is flashing, the
memory mode is canceled, so wait until it has stopped flashing
before you press another button.
{Recalling]
Press the AUTO SOURCE CONTROL button (1 or 2) for the
settings that you want to recall.
Remote control's AUTO SOURCE CONTROL buttons (ASC
1 or 2) can also be used to recall settings.
"AUTO SOURCE CONTROL 1 (or 2)" is scroll displayed. After
the last indication, such as "PLAY CD" has been scroll
displayed, the display switches to function indications.
In the case of the example, the following operations are performed:
@ Press the AUTO SOURCE CONTROL 1 button.
@ Power to the receiver switches ON, the input selector
selects CD, settings for such parameters as surround, are
called up, and power to the CD player is switched ON.
@ Play starts on the CD player.

NOTE:
+ Since the power ON and play signals for components bearing the
§@] mark called by Auto source control are output through this unit's
CONTROL OUT jack, be sure to connect the control cord (refer to
page 11).
With some components, even if they bear the
| mark, power
cannot be switched on and off by remote control.
If this is the
case, by connecting the other unit's power cord to this unit's
SWITCHED AC OUTLET, and leaving the other unit's power switch
ON, power switching will depend on whether this unit is on or off.
+ AUTO SOURCE CONTROL memory stores the receiver settings
at that point in time; it does not memorize
STATION CALL numbers
(1-30). (The frequency is memorized.)
* During the operation of AUTO
SOURCE
CONTROL,
other
components are also being controlled, so do not perform other
operations until it is finished.
